On 11/8/97 10:24 AM, Doug McClure (closer@scescape.net) wrote:

>We're getting mass failure of MacTCP 2.0.6 dialins with ComOS 3.7.2 on our
>Portmaster. Not restricted to any one modem; the computer dials, negotiates,
>but will only pull up our local domain. Anyone have a solution or explanation
>for this?

Did you specify the domain name servers like this:
cmc.net 206.102.31.250
. 206.102.31.250

If you don't have a . entry in MacTCP, you won't be able to find any
external sites.
